Papa John's to close hundreds of restaurants
Papa John's plans to close 300 underperforming restaurants in North America by 2027, with 200 closures expected this year, CFO Ravi Thanawala said.

Stanley Black & Decker to cut hundreds of jobs, shut Connecticut plant
Stanley Black & Decker will eliminate about 300 jobs and close a Connecticut tape-measure plant as demand declines, part of its multiyear restructuring plan.
